# HUMAN RESOURCES MANAGEMENT OFFICER

Qualification:
Holding down a key Middle Management position, with full responsibility for creating a conducive work environment, the incumbent will be responsible for:
•    Manpower Planning and Development: PartiCipate in recruitment, inductionj orientation, confirmation, career management, promotion, .as well as competence and performance management
•    Employee Relations – Manage employee communication and involvement, disciplinary/ grievance procedure and disengagement process
•    Benefits and Compensation: Administer wages and salaries, incentive schemes management, pensions/ provident fund and statutory contributions
•    Learning and Development: Undertake training needs assessment, pre and post training evaluation, training implementation and developmental programme execution/ assessment

Requirement:

•    Degree qualified in Social Sciences, Humanities or related field. MBA in HR will be an added advantage
•    At least 10 years’ experience in Human Resources, 2 of which must be in a multinational environment
•    Experience in oil and gas industry would he an advantage
•    Hands-on experience in Manpower Planning and Development, Employee Relations, Benefits and Compensation Management as well as Learning and Development will enhance suitability of applicants
•    Must be a member of the Chartered Institute of Personnel Management of Nigeria Our client offers competitive compensation and an exciting work environment.

#MANAGING DIRECTOR


Qualification

  • Degree qualified in Engineering, Business Management, Procurement or related field.
  • Not less than 20 years’ post graduate experience, with at least 7 years in a senior management role.
  •  Knowledge of business development, procurement, supply chain and contract management.
  •  Deep knowledge of financial forecasting and manaqement, auditing and financial reporting.
  • Previous experience in the oil and gas industry, energy sector or transportation will be an advantage.
  • Commercially astute and with proven P&L responsibility and track record of growing revenue, cost management, and delivery against KPls.
  • Experience of process redesign and operations management.
  •  Practical experience of sales, marketing, customer management and account management.
  • Visible leadership skills within challenging performance environments.
  • Superior communication and presentation skills.
  • Excellent PC skills including MS Office, Internet e.t.c.


Responsibilities:


  • Holding down a critical Senior Management position, with full responsibility for P&L of the company in Nigeria, the incumbent will be responsible for:
  •  Strategic Orientation: Defining and establishing overall Strategic Business Plan, including goals and objectives in the short, medium and long term.
  •  Process and Operational Imperatives: Align company’s process and operational models to contract agreement, whilst ensuring consistent and quality delivery on client expectations.
  •   People Management and Organisational Development: Create effective teams and enabling environment that allows people employ their talents in achieving organisational objectives in a mutually beneficial relationship.
  •  Customer Service and Financial Leadership: Partner internal and external customers to deliver world-class service and ensure consistent achievement of corporate financial Objectives, including budgets and regulatory/ statutory requirements.
  •  Technology/Innovation: Employ cutting-edge technology and innovativeness to deliver niche leadership in the oil and gas industry in Nigeria.
